    why are they putting the national anthem on TV if it's only TV?

  • @bobsims727
    @bobsims7274 жыл бұрын

    Diego Gabriel Corcuera because in the early days of terrestrial broadcasting the stations didn’t broadcast 24/7. They would shut down the transmitters overnight. When they started up their broadcast day they would power up the transmitters and play the national anthem. This sign off/on format was honored in this last sign off as thy would have done in the early days.
